Official abstract text for this publication.
A product resulting from the reaction of at least: a hydroxybenzoic acid, optionally substituted by a hydrocarbyl group, a boron compound, an amine component selected from a di-fatty-alkyl(ene) polyalkylamine composition including one or more polyalkylamines of formulae (I) or (II). A lubricant composition includes this product. Use of this product as a lubricant for two-stroke marine engines and four-stroke marine engines, more preferably two-stroke marine engines.

The invention claimed is: 1. A product resulting from the reaction of at least: a hydroxybenzoic acid, optionally substituted by a hydrocarbyl group, a boron compound, an amine component selected from a di-fatty-alkyl(ene) polyalkylamine composition comprising one or more polyalkylamines of formulae (I) or (II): wherein, each R is, independent of the other R, an alkyl moiety or an alkylene moiety with 4 to 30 carbon atoms, which is linear or branched, n and z are independent of each other either 0, 1, 2, or 3, and when z is greater-than 0 then o and p are independent of each other either 0, 1, 2, or 3, or derivatives thereof selected from products wherein one or more of the NH moieties of the dialkyl polyalkylamines are methylated, alkoxylated, or both, whereby said polyalkylamine composition comprises at least 3% by weight of branched compounds of formula (I) or (II), with regards to the total weight of polyalkylamine compounds (I) and (II) in the composition, branched compound signifying that: in formula (I) at least one of n and z are greater than or equal to 1, in formula (II) n is greater than or equal to 1. 2. The product according to claim 1 , wherein the hydroxybenzoic acid, optionally substituted by a hydrocarbyl group, is selected from the group consisting of: mono-alk(en)yl substituted salicylic acids, di-alk(en)yl substituted salicylic acids, acid functionalized calixarenes and mixtures thereof. 3. The product according to claim 1 , wherein the hydroxybenzoic acid compound, optionally substituted by a hydrocarbyl group, corresponds to formula (III): Wherein: X represents a hydrocarbyl with 1 to 50 carbon atoms, and X can comprise one or more heteroatoms, a is an integer, a represents 0, 1 or 2. 4. The product according to claim 3 , wherein X comprises from 12 to 40 carbon atoms. 5. The product according to claim 3 , wherein the hydroxybenzoic acid compound, optionally substituted by a hydrocarbyl group, corresponds to formula (IIIA): 6. The product according to claim 5 , wherein the hydroxybenzoic acid compound is salicylic acid. 7. The product according to claim 1 , wherein the boron compound is selected from the group consisting of: boric acid, boric acid complexes, boric oxide, a trialkyl borate in which the alkyl groups comprise independently from 1 to 4 carbon atoms, a C 1 -C 12 alkyl boronic acid, a C 1 -C 12 dialkyl boric acid, a C 6 -C 12 aryl boric acid, a C 6 -C 12 diaryl boric acid, a C 7 -C 12 aralkyl boric acid, a C 7 -C 12 diaralkyl boric acid, and products deriving from these by substitution of an alkyl group by one or more alkoxy unit. 8. The product according to claim 7 , wherein the boron compound is boric acid. 9. The product according to claim 1 , wherein the polyalkylamine composition comprises at least 4% w/w of branched compounds of formula (I) or (II), with regards to the total weight of polyalkylamine compounds (I) and (II) in the composition, branched compound signifying that: in formula (I), at least one of n or z are greater than or equal to 1, in formula (II), n is greater than or equal to 1. 10. The product according to claim 1 , wherein the polyalkylamine composition comprises at least 5% by weight, with regards to the total weight of compounds (I) and (II), of products of formulae (I) and (II) with a linear structure, linear meaning n is 0 in formulae (I) and (II) and z is 0 in formula (I). 11. The product according to claim 1 , wherein the polyalkylamine composition further comprises derivatives of polyalkylamines of formula (I) or (II), said derivatives are alkoxylates which are optionally methylated. 12. The product according to claim 1 , wherein the polyalkylamine composition further comprises derivatives of polyalkylamines of formula (I) or (II), said derivatives are methylated. 13. The product according to claim 1 , wherein each R is, independent of the other R, a linear or branched alkyl group or alkenyl group comprising 8 to 22 carbon atoms. 14. The product according to claim 13 , wherein each R is, independent of the other R, a linear or branched alkyl group or alkenyl group comprising 14 to 18 carbon atoms. 15. The product according to claim 13 , wherein R groups are derived from animal and vegetal oils and fats and mixtures thereof. 16. The product according to claim 15 , wherein R groups are derived from tallow oil. 17. A lubricant composition comprising at least one product according to claim 1 and at least one base oil. 18. A lubricant composition according to claim 17 comprising: from 60 to 99.9% of the at least one base oil, from 0.1 to 20% of the at least one product. 19. Method for lubricating two-stroke marine engines and four-stroke marine engines comprising application to said marine engines of a product according to claim 1 . 20. Method for lubricating two-stroke marine engines and four-stroke marine engines comprising application to said marine engines of a lubricant composition according to claim 17 .
